Expert Tips: Natural Plant Cultivation Methods You Should Be Aware Of

To cultivate a thriving, chemical-free garden , seasoned gardeners suggest several crucial organic techniques. Begin by enriching your soil with compost and other natural materials; this improves aeration and provides here essential sustenance . Crop sequencing is also vital – alternating plant families minimizes diseases and prevents nutrient depletion. Consider incorporating beneficial organisms, like ladybugs, to control unwanted visitors . Lastly, embrace companion planting; combining certain plants can actually enhance growth and deter damaging elements.

Revamp Your Garden : Innovative Organic Gardening Tips

Want a lush garden without harsh chemicals? Embracing organic methods is easier than you think! Here are some fresh ideas to boost your gardening game. First, consider companion planting – pairing plants that benefit each other, like tomatoes and basil, can deter pests and increase yields. Next, build soil health with compost; it's nature's fertilizer! You can create your own from kitchen scraps and yard waste. Alternatively , purchase high-quality organic amendments to enrich your soil. Don’t overlook the power of beneficial insects – attract ladybugs, lacewings, and praying mantises to control unwanted pests naturally. Lastly, try vertical gardening techniques such as pallet planters or living walls to maximize space in smaller areas; it's a fantastic way to grow more food or flowers!
